ASSOCIATE DIRECTOR - GLOBAL CLINICAL PROGRAM MANAGEMENT - OBSERVATIONAL RESEARCH
LIVE
What you will do
In this vital role, you will lead the operational delivery of complex clinical programs, ensuring studies are executed with quality, speed, and efficiency to bring innovative medicines to patients.
You will provide strategic input into study planning and design, anticipate risks, and partner closely with cross-functional and local teams to align execution with program strategy, timelines, and budgets.
The responsibilities of the role will include:
- Leading operational planning and delivery across multiple clinical studies or programs.
- Providing strategic input on study design, country selection, enrollment, diversity, and patient-centric approaches.
- Identifying and mitigating delivery risks to maintain progress and performance.
- Driving consistent, high-quality operational practices across assigned programs.
- Line-managing and developing Study Delivery Leads with clear objectives and accountability.
- Managing program-level budgets, vendors, and forecasting while embedding lessons learned and continuous improvement.
- Overseeing program-level issues, risks, and escalations to ensure timely resolution.
- Partnering cross-functionally to align priorities, resources, and execution plans.

What we expect of you
We are all different, yet we all use our unique contributions to serve patients. What we seek in you as an experienced professional, are these qualifications and skills:
- Degree educated
- Clinical trial execution experience and previous people leadership managing teams, projects, resources or directing the allocation of resources
- Previous experience in life sciences or a related field, including biopharmaceutical clinical observational research
- Experience working with or overseeing clinical research vendors (e.g., CROs, central labs, imaging)
- Strong experience managing multiple teams / direct reports across multiple geographies
